What is the average MOT pass rate for a Mercedes Hymer Motorhome?

The Mercedes Hymer Motorhome has an average 86.2% MOT pass rate across model years 1987 to 2012, based on DVSA test data.

What are the most common MOT failures on a Mercedes Hymer Motorhome?

The most common MOT failure reasons for the Mercedes Hymer Motorhome across all years are: audible warning inoperative, brake pipe damaged or excessively corroded, a suspension pin, bush or joint excessively worn. These are typical wear items that can often be checked and addressed before your test.
